Vygotsky
Lev Vygotsky, a Russian psychologist known for his theory on social development and the concept of the Zone of Proximal Development.
Formal Operations
The stage in Piaget’s theory of cognitive development where adolescents and adults develop the ability to think about abstract concepts and logically test hypotheses.
Concrete Operations
A stage in cognitive development, according to Piaget, where children gain the ability to think logically about concrete events.
Preoperational Thought
A stage in cognitive development, according to Jean Piaget, where children aged 2-7 years are capable of using symbols and language but do not yet understand concrete logic.
